Episode Description

Karen Millsap lost her husband tragically at the age of 29 when he was killed. As a young mother she also had to continue to care for her young child, while working and grieving all at the same time. As it happens, tough times will make or break us. Not only did Karen make the decision that this was going to "make" her a better and stronger person. She decided to take it beyond herself and expand what she learned, to the world. She now has developed a Soul Care community where she teaches the powerful self-care tools she learned in her master classes. Karen will also teach the audience a powerful mindfulness technique that she created called STOP & SHIFT. It helps us move from negative thinking to clarity and peace of mind. Karin Weiri

Karin Weiri is a licensed Marriage and Family Therapist and Break Through Life Coach. Her passion is to relieve people of the trauma that hold people in negative behavior patterns so they can finally breathe, live, BE! When asked what she does for a living, she will often respond by saying, “I do magic!” with a wink, an all-knowing smile, and a sparkle in her eye. Because that is truly how it feels most days.

Before her glamorous private practice gig, she spent the first decade of her career in non-profit agencies in Volusia County, Florida. During those years she worked with domestic violence, mental health, substance abuse, child abuse, and did in home and in school counseling with children and their families. She continues to be on-call for on-site crisis services for Employee Assistant Programs providing first hand briefing when an incident has occurred that may negatively affect employees if left unnoticed.

Karin works in her private practice in Orange City, Florida. She has her Master’s Degree from Stetson University in Deland, Florida and went through Francine Shapiro’s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ing training.
